Apollo Nida, the ex-husband of former "Real Housewives of Atlanta" reality star Phaedra Parks, has been released from prison and is currently living at a halfway house after serving five years of his sentence for fraud charges, E! Online reports.

After being released from prison, Nida was seen with his fiancée, Sherien Almufti, whom he met while behind bars. According to The Blast, the two were photographed on Sunday in Philadelphia, where she works as a real estate agent.

Almufti wrote on social media about Nida in 2017, defending him by writing, “You have been misunderstood, judged and ridiculed but you never allowed it to bring you down. The strength you have gives me life. You’re such an amazing person inside and out. One day the world will see that! In the meantime, stay prayed up, stay strong and keep pushing.”

She added, “Love you so much, can’t wait for the day we reunite, it’s going to be magical!”

It is unclear whether or not Nida has had contact with Parks, with whom he shares two boys with, Dylan and Ayden. Nida and Parks ended their five-year marriage in 2017. The two had previously starred on the Bravo TV series together.

In 2014, Nida pleaded guilty to a fraud scheme that prosecutors said resulted in the loss of over $2 million from more than 50 people over a four-year period.

After his original sentencing, his attorney, Thomas D. Bever, told E! News, "On behalf of my client Apollo, right now he feels remorse. He thought the judge was fair, and accepts his sentence, although he was hoping it would be less. Apollo is elated that this proceeding is past him and is no longer handing [sic] over his head...He's OK, and will get through this."

Nida is expected to remain in a halfway house in Philadelphia until October.
